How do you know if a scholarship is legit?

Most scholarship scams charge some kind of a fee. The fee may be small and reasonable, such as an application fee, processing fee or taxes, but legitimate scholarships do not charge any fees. Requests unusual information. Beware of scholarships that ask for your credit card number or Social Security Number.

What info should you never provide for a scholarship?

Avoid giving personal information

Reputable scholarship providers generally require basic information such as your name, year in school and email address, but students should never give personal or financial data such as their Social Security number, driver's license number, banking information or credit-card number.

Can you pocket scholarship money?

One reason it's so difficult is because most scholarship payments are sent directly to the school and are only allowed to be put toward tuition and fees. In most cases, the student doesn't get to keep any leftover money for personal use, though some colleges do issue refunds, said Kantrowitz.

Is Master free in Germany?

Fees and funding

This means you can study a Masters in Germany for free, whether you are a German, EU or non-EU student. However, the following exceptions may apply: Fees may still be charged at private universities. However, most of the German higher education system is publically funded.

Is it hard to get a DAAD scholarship?

DAAD scholarship requirements aren't too difficult to meet. To secure DAAD funding, applicants must have completed a Bachelors degree or be in their final year of studies. There is no upper age limit, although there may be a maximum time between finishing your Bachelors and taking up a DAAD grant.

Can I study free in Germany?

In 2014, Germany's 16 states abolished tuition fees for undergraduate students at all public German universities. This means that currently both domestic and international undergraduates at public universities in Germany can study for free, with just a small fee to cover administration and other costs per semester.

How much money do I need to study in Germany?

Cost of living Around 850 euros a month for living expenses. Compared to some other European countries, Germany is not very expensive. The costs of food, housing, clothing and cultural activities are slightly higher than the EU average. On average, students in Germany spend around 850 euros per month on living costs.

Is PhD in Germany for free?

The good news is that tuition for a doctorate at a German university is basically free – at least at public higher education institutions. This applies to the individual PhD and to structured PhD programmes.
